Abstract :
This paper explores the measuring similarity between the web objects which are one of the fundamental task in information retrieval domain. This paper proposes a framework for improved and efficient web object search based on search domain. The concept of proposed approach defines the similarity between two objects (object can be a link or text content) and retrieve the related links with their content descriptor according to user´s interest. The proposed framework can retrieve the similar web objects in effective and faster way by eliminating the redundant objects. The proposed algorithm is experimentally tested and the results shows improvement in fast and effective retrieval of web links. The proposed algorithm automatically extracts web links based on user interests. Furthermore, in accordance with user interest´s web objects mined and feedbacks of users are assessed for effective retrieval with an idea of dynamically adjusting the ranking scores of Web Pages based on similarity measures.
